Rushworth M. Kidder

Rushworth Moulton Kidder (1944–2012) was an American author, ethicist, journalist, and professor best known for founding the Institute for Global Ethics. He wrote books including "Moral Courage" and "How Good People Make Tough Choices: Resolving the Dilemmas of Ethical Living," and also covered topics ranging from poetry to ethics and civil discourse.
